How to get started in Robotics?
A Robot is a machine that executes a series of actions automatically. Not all robots look like a human. Such robots are called humanoid robots. There are other types of robots which we will take up some other time.
The main question that is answered in this article is how do we start getting into the field of robotics. The functioning of robot involves a collaboration of different fields.
The skills required for a robot to function can be classified into the following:
- Core Skills
- Sense
- Brain
- Body
Core Skills
Every individual working in the field needs to have some core skills to perform the best in the field of robotics.
Mathematics – A good grasp of geometry and algebra are essential skills for all aspects of robotics.
Physics – Physics is another area where you need to have good grasp in, especially in electronics, electrical, materials and general physics related to motion and energy.
Sense
The sensory parts of the robot could consist of components like: light sensors, cameras, heat detectors, weight sensors or any other component that could provide digital data inputs. You need to have a good knowledge in electronics, embedded systems, control theory and electrical engineering. People working in this area usually come from Electronics and Electrical Engineering streams like B.Tech/M.Tech in Electronics or Electrical Engineering.
Brain
The brain should be capable of taking decision and processing critical information on behalf of the other components. You need to have good knowledge in software design, programming, embedded systems, computer hardware, artificial intelligence. People working in this area usually come from Software Engineering stream like B.Tech/M.Tech in Computer Science.
Body
This area focuses on the physical aspects of the robot. You need to have good knowledge in mechanical engineering, material designing, manufacturing, etc. People working in this area usually comes from Mechanical Engineering and Product Designing streams like B.Tech/M.Tech in Mechanical Engineering or Product Design courses.
Apart from these skills you will also need to have to be an avid learner, shows interest in other streams and have a lot of patience.
Starting in the field of Robotics
Now to answer the main question; How to start in the field of Robotics. There is no single course that would introduce you to robotics.
- First and foremost, you should have good grasp in mathematics and physics.
- Choose your favourite stream: Sense, Brain or Body.
- Do your undergraduate / graduate courses in the stream you have chosen.
- Keep learning
- Play with tools like Raspberry Pi, Drones, etc
- Participate in Robotics Competitions